Reaction | Comment | Organism | Reaction ID |
---|---|---|---|
degradation of gelatin; little activity on hemoglobin. Specificity on B chain of insulin more restricted than that of pepsin A; does not cleave at Phe1-Val, Gln4-His or Gly23-Phe | mechanism, concerted action of different pepsins | Sus scrofa |
